    but thought I would share this project made jointly by my brother who does woodworking and myself for a dear friend of the family. She loves hummingbirds and has a lot of them come through every year. So I found a pattern that my brother cut out with his scroll saw, I painted the piece and then used some Timtex for stabilizing the fabric to place behind it. I think it turned out okay and am leaving right now to give it to her for her birthday. What do you guys think?
